Europe has voted – What does the rightward shift mean for energy?

About this episode

Right-wing parties have made gains in the EU parliamentary elections this past week, but a coalition of centrists remains likely. 

Correspondent Camilla Naschert tells host Taylor Kuykendall what the result means for energy policymaking in the 27-member bloc.

The main message: Net zero is still on, but the pace of climate lawmaking may slow in coming years.
